image 'Fluffi Bunni' hacking suspect arrested image
Crack Attack

BunnyBritish police have arrested a man suspected of hacking into high-profile corporate Web sites and defacing them with a distinct digital calling card: a "fluffy" pink bunny rabbit.

New Scotland Yard said Wednesday it arrested 24-year-old Lynn Htun at a London convention center, the site of InfoSecurity Europe 2003, one of Europe's largest trade fairs for Internet and computer network security.

Law enforcement and Internet security professionals said they believe Htun is the mastermind behind the "Fluffi Bunni" hacking exploits, which European and US authorities have been investigating for more than a year.

Fluffi Bunni has been active for more than two years, hacking into sites ranging from McDonald's site to those of Net security specialists SANS Institute and Symantec's virus detection group, SecurityFocus, according to sources.

In a time when Web sites of many organisations are hacked on a daily basis, these intrusions stood out. The defaced Web pages often carried a message along the lines "this site is now controlled by Fluffi Bunni" beside an image of a stuffed pink rabbit.

"Fluffi Bunni is one of the most mysterious figures in the hacking panorama. He selects specific targets. His hacks are very effective," said Roberto Preatoni, founder of Zone-H, a firm that monitors and records Internet hack attacks.

Htun, a British citizen, had not been charged late as of late Wednesday with any computer-related crimes.

Police said he was arrested Tuesday by officers from the Computer Crime Unit of New Scotland Yard on a warrant for skipping an appearance at Guildford Crown Court, where he was to appear for an unrelated forgery charge.

A law enforcement source said the investigation was continuing as authorities were trying to determine whether Fluffi Bunni was the work of a single person or a group, which could lead to other arrests and determine whether Htun is charged.
